Jasper: Journey to the End of the World (2009)
Between the icy South Pole and a colorful sea-port, plays the adventure of the penguin brothers Jasper and Junior, who, with the help of 9 year old Emma, retrieve the eggs of a threatened parrot species from the evil Dr. Block.
Director: Eckart Fingberg, Kay Delventhal
Genre: Family, Animation, Adventure
Runtime: 80 min
Release Date: August 13, 2009
